The concept
The vehicle alarm system responds to:
- Opening of a door, the hood or the trunk lid.
- Movements in the vehicle: interior motion sensor.
- Changes in the vehicle tilt, e.g., during attempts to steal a wheel or when towing the car.
- Interruptions in battery voltage.
The alarm system briefly indicates tampering:
- By sounding an acoustic alarm.
- By switching on the hazard warning system.
- By flashing the high beams.
